Does Prayer Changes Anything?

30/8/2011

0 Comments

 
Picture
Does prayer changes your circumstances? 
No, not always, but it changes the way you look at your circumstances and situations.

Does prayer changes your shattered dreams and past regrets? 
No, not always but it shifts where you draw your strength and comfort from.

Does prayer changes your wants and desires? 
Yes, it purifies your desires to align with God’s purpose in your life.

Does prayer change your life? Yes, it does.

We look at prayer simply as a means of obtaining things from God but the biblical purpose of prayer is that we may get to know God deeper, to delight in HIM and HIS heart.  Prayer is not a matter of changing your external circumstances  but more to working miracles in a person’s inner nature. 

We all have heard the phrase “Don’t expect a different result if you keep doing the same thing”.  When we pray, prayer changes us and we will eventually change the way we do things. When we do so, we will get a different result. A better result.

Does prayer change anything? Yes, it changes everything.

Psalm 37:4
Take delight in the Lord and He will give you your heart’s desires.

What Do You See?

26/8/2011

0 Comments

 
Picture
Esref Armagan is a remarkable Turkish man who loves to paint. Although his artwork may not be deemed impressive by all, what makes this man remarkable is, he is completely blind.

Esref was born without eyes but it doesn't stop him from pursuing his passion to paint. His unusual condition has given him a remarkable acknowledgment that is unheard of by most people.

Esref is able to paint although he has never seen colours, objects or even the face of the former US president, Bill Clinton, yet he painted a portrait of him. When asked how he can do it, he simply answers that he believes what he sees in his mind and paints it to the canvas, bringing it to life.

Skeptic scientists who studied Esref’s brain via a MRI Scan couldn’t even explain how his inactive brain region could react and lit up actively whenever he is painting. “No one can call me blind, I can see more with my fingers than sighted people can see with their eyes,” he says.

Esref doesn’t have to see to believe, he sees because he believes. What a beautiful picture of faith. Believing requires no sight, it starts from the mind and the heart.  

When you close your eyes, what do you see through your eyes of faith? 

Do you see your breakthrough?

John 20:29 
Because you have seen me, you have believed; blessed are those who have not seen and yet have believed.

With God it is Possible

19/8/2011

0 Comments

 
Picture
Nothing is Impossible. The word itself says “I’m possible” – Audrey Hepburn.

The quote reminded me of the film ‘Soul Surfer’. It tells of an inspiring true story of a 13 years old surfer girl, Bethany Hamilton, whose arm was bitten off by a 14-foot tiger shark back in 2003.

Despite the odds, she kept her faith and is determined to re-learn to surf competitively with just one arm. Knowing the challenges that lay ahead, the young girl says, “I don’t need easy. I just need possible.” 

When challenges strike, won’t it be nice to have an easy way out? Unfortunately, in most cases, there is no such thing as an easy exit but difficult doesn’t mean it is not do-able. 

While certain breakthrough hoped for might seem hopeless, Jesus offered the assurance that -

What is impossible with men is possible with God – Luke 18:27
